I'm very familiar with the height problem.

Surprisingly some of the older DRBs have adequate leg room, and of course the new Absolute Paces are probably the market leader in interior space on a 90" wheelbase but I haven't seen a used Pace for sale yet. The stretched Harrisons are another to consider if you're not hung up on their being 4" over the "proper" length. In most cases you can't pick the difference anyway.

Unless you're handy with tools and have the time and patience to embark on a build, you're probably better off looking for a used one. Despite their reputation most Cobras haven't been flogged to death. I'd suggest you widen your search and no doubt you'll come across some obviously poorly thought out examples along the way, but, when you eventually find one that takes your breath away and makes you feel you can't live without it, before you make any rash decisions be aware that there'd be any number of very knowledgeable guys in the various state Cobra clubs who would be prepared to assist you in determining if that car is indeed the one that will make you happy for years to come. It's hard not to be overcome with relief and excitement when you finally find "the one" but really, stay calm, talk to someone who knows what he's looking at and be guided by his advice.
